Is the GMC Terrain a good car?
Yes — the GMC Terrain earns strong marks from owners across the lineup. The all-generations owner rating is 4.58/5 across every model year in the data.
Owners consistently praise the Terrain for its comfort, roomy cabin, and smooth driving experience. They also frequently highlight its easy-to-use technology and strong safety features, along with the appeal of AWD in everyday driving.
Expert reviews rate the 2022 and 2018 models among the highest across all years.
The main trade-offs center on sluggish acceleration, interior materials that feel less polished in some years, and cargo space that trails some rivals. Those are the kinds of compromises you weigh against the Terrain’s comfort-first character and feature-rich setup.
28.0% of listings are priced as good or great deals.
Are GMC Terrain models reliable?
Owners and experts repeatedly point to the Terrain’s comfort, smooth ride, and roomy cabin as core strengths. Across the model years, reviews also emphasize its easy-to-live-with character and the way its technology and safety features add everyday confidence.
- Owners rate the GMC Terrain between 4.33 and 5.0 out of 5 stars across all model years in the data.
For used buyers, long-term ownership risk is most worth watching on older model years, where reliability concerns and wear-related issues can matter more.

Which GMC Terrain trim should I buy?
The 2022 GMC Terrain offers these trims:
- SLE: The more affordable starting point, with standard front-wheel drive and the core Terrain comfort-and-tech setup.
- SLT: A stronger value choice if you want a more upscale feel while keeping the Terrain’s everyday comfort and convenience.
- AT4: The rugged-looking trim with standard all-wheel drive, sport-terrain tires, a steel front skid plate, Off-Road mode, and Hill Descent Control.
- Denali: The luxury-leaning trim that adds a layer of refinement and includes the GMC Pro Safety Plus Package standard.

Should I buy a used GMC Terrain now or wait for the next model?
Buy now if:
- Price trend: The 2025 model is at −11.11% versus a year ago, and the 2024 model is at −3.9%.
- Deal availability: The 2025 model has 29% good and great deals, and the 2024 model has 29.3%.
- Sweet-spot year: The 2023 model has the most listings at a current average price of $24,643. The GMC Terrain offers a comfortable ride, a roomy cabin, and a polished, premium-leaning character.
Consider waiting if:
- Powertrain/efficiency: Every 2022 GMC Terrain has a turbocharged 1.5-liter four-cylinder engine making 170 horsepower and 203 pound-feet of torque. The 1.5-liter can handle a trailer weighing up to 1,500 pounds.
- Tech: GMC offers Terrain buyers two different infotainment systems. With SLE trim, a 7-inch touchscreen display is standard, while the SLT, AT4, and Denali come with a high-definition 8-inch touchscreen.
- Safety: Every 2022 GMC Terrain has a GMC Pro Safety Package as standard equipment. This collection of driver-assist and collision-avoidance systems includes forward-collision warning, pedestrian detection, automatic emergency braking, lane-departure warning, lane-keeping assist, automatic high-beam headlights, and a following distance indicator.
- Starting price: GMC loaded it up with the Tech Package, Infotainment Package II, GMC Pro Safety Plus Package, a Skyscape panoramic sunroof, and a three-year subscription to OnStar services, bringing the Manufacturer’s Suggested Retail Price (MSRP) to $41,810, including the $1,395 destination charge.
If you're buying used today, the 2023 model year offers the best mix of value and availability. If you want the latest tech and features, it may be worth waiting for 2028 inventory to mature.
